Abstract :
For a continuous-time linear system with saturating actuators, it is known that, irrespective of the locations of the open-loop poles, both global and semi-global finite gain Lp-stabilization are achievable, by nonlinear and linear feedback respectively, and the Lp gain can also be made arbitrarily small. We show that, these results do not hold for discrete-time systems
